apprenticeshipn.1. The service or condition of an apprentice; the state in which a person is gaining instruction in a trade or art, under legal agreement.()2. The time an apprentice is serving (sometimes seven years, as from the age of fourteen to twenty-one).()a.[p. p. appress, which is not in use. See Adpress.] (Bot.)
